I don't get it, is it possible to be jet skiing without knowing how to swim?
It is not necessary that you must know how to swim before you ride on a jet ski but there are safety requirements before getting oneself on a large mass of water!
At Good beach and landmark you are required to put on your life jacket!
And must be in company of a trained lifeguard.
And there must be clearance on that day that the waters are safe to go in

According to the post, his body sunk too deep to be rescued..

If he drowned without anything pulling him down his body would have been floating.... which means he had an accident and his clothes or shoes/sports trainers or shoe lace or part of his body was stuck or entangled with the jet ski and pulled him down deeper into ocean...

In this case, knowing how to swim wouldn't save him because something is continuously pulling him deeper into the ocean and he would be panicking because he would have to release himself from the sinking jet ski while in the water or whatever was pulling him deeper into the ocean..

but the report didn't say whether the jet ski sunk or not.
